Output c76bab28070b46f21630cb5460333d31679c3e619cc0ddb9182d7297b1a51a5e:0

value
2070660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39cd826fdebbdfea08c8af50e2095ef74638716 OP_EQUAL
address
3Pu81tqyK8FHcyGHrDbxbkyYiWRY33KVdE
transaction
c76bab28070b46f21630cb5460333d31679c3e619cc0ddb9182d7297b1a51a5e
spent
true